Sensory Rooms for Special Education Needs

The main feature of special education is that children go through a development customized to the capabilities of the individual child. This means that the children deserve an appropriate place in the education system where the child is challenged and where their potential and their disability is taken into account.

A MSE/Snoezelenroom for this group has a great added and supportive role in advancing development that is based on the possibilities. Within the MSE/snoezelenroom activities can be offered that connect to the learning lines. By making use of a deliberate and methodical approach within the snoezelenroom the facilitator can let a student to relax, observe and development or influence behavior.

For this individual target group we design the MSE based on its unique five principles:

  1. It is a place of rest and relaxation to improve concentration.
  2. It is supporting the development of skills.
  3. It offers activities to increase self control.
  4. It is a challenging area that seduces the child to explore.
  5. It consists of flexible equipment that can be adapted to the needs of the child.
